diff options
| author | Uros Majstorovic <majstor@majstor.org> | 2022-02-02 06:40:10 +0100 | 
|---|---|---|
| committer | Uros Majstorovic <majstor@majstor.org> | 2022-02-02 06:40:10 +0100 | 
| commit | 64b55e7e1236121ea4197d9a37cfec43b196cfe8 (patch) | |
| tree | eb16f4a2d3eae3d9485eccbd923812a56b627979 /ecp/src/msgq.h | |
| parent | a4401c99c2a54ba9a964317cbff915d40d16e470 (diff) | |
moved ecp, platform -> src
Diffstat (limited to 'ecp/src/msgq.h')
| -rw-r--r-- | ecp/src/msgq.h | 22 | 
1 files changed, 0 insertions, 22 deletions
diff --git a/ecp/src/msgq.h b/ecp/src/msgq.h deleted file mode 100644 index 394209f..0000000 --- a/ecp/src/msgq.h +++ /dev/null @@ -1,22 +0,0 @@ -#ifdef ECP_WITH_MSGQ - -#define ECP_MSGQ_MAX_MSG        32 - -typedef struct ECPConnMsgQ { -    unsigned short idx_w[ECP_MAX_MTYPE]; -    unsigned short idx_r[ECP_MAX_MTYPE]; -    ecp_seq_t seq_start; -    ecp_seq_t seq_max; -    ecp_seq_t seq_msg[ECP_MAX_MTYPE][ECP_MSGQ_MAX_MSG]; -    pthread_cond_t cond[ECP_MAX_MTYPE]; -    pthread_mutex_t mutex; -} ECPConnMsgQ; - -int ecp_conn_msgq_create(ECPConnMsgQ *msgq); -void ecp_conn_msgq_destroy(ECPConnMsgQ *msgq); -int ecp_conn_msgq_start(ECPConnMsgQ *msgq, ecp_seq_t seq); - -int ecp_conn_msgq_push(struct ECPConnection *conn, ecp_seq_t seq, unsigned char mtype); -ssize_t ecp_conn_msgq_pop(struct ECPConnection *conn, unsigned char mtype, unsigned char *msg, size_t msg_size, ecp_cts_t timeout); - -#endif  /* ECP_WITH_MSGQ */
\ No newline at end of file  | 
